MICHAEL THOMAS MADDEN

Michael Madden

Feb. 3, 1935 – Dec. 14, 2023

Michael Thomas Madden passed away peacefully on Dec. 14, 2023, in Alpena. Born on Feb. 3, 1935, in Cheboygan, Michigan, to the late Thomas and Elizabeth (Dore) Madden, Mike was a beacon of kindness and love throughout his 88 years of life.

Mike grew up in a warm, nurturing home alongside his siblings. He is survived by his brother, Thomas (Susan) Madden, his sister, Liza (Bill) Sandall, and was preceded in death by his brother, Dennis, and sisters, Ann and Virginia. He was a cherished figure in his family, a loving father to Susan (Mark) Strickfaden and Janet (Michael) Jenkins, and a doting grandfather to Steven Strickfaden, Brendan (Molly) Jenkins, Erin (Logan) Hutson, Christie (Ben) Reis, and Maria (Nick) Cameron. His joy was further multiplied by the presence of his seven great-grandchildren and several nieces and nephews.

Mike was preceded in death by his beloved wife, Maryann Piaskowski, with whom he shared a devoted marriage from 1958 until her passing in 2016. Mike’s heart would eventually hold a special place for Judy Nordstrand, his significant other, who was by his side, sharing in life’s adventures and quiet moments alike.

Professionally, Mike made his mark as a purchasing agent for the Alpena County Road Commission before managing at Motion Industries until his retirement. His leadership skills shone brightly as he served as president of the Kiwanis Club, the Alpena Golf Association, and the Alpena Country Club. His athletic spirit was evident from his youth, having been a letterman in football during high school.

Mike’s passions were manifold. He found joy in the companionship of his Jack Russell terriers — Scooter, Skeeter, and Popcorn. His love for golf was well-known, as were his winter retreats to Florida, which provided a warm respite from Michigan’s chilly winters. An avid scrapbooker, he preserved memories with meticulous care, each album a testament to the rich life he led and the people he cherished.

A devout Catholic, Mike served as an altar server at St. Bernard Catholic Church and recited the Rosary daily, his faith a guiding light through all seasons of life.
